The Heads Up approach:
Show students that change is both possible and achievable
We've identified the most demonstrably effective techniques for improving social connectedness and well-being, and have consolidated these into a comprehensive, easy-to-access package. “There is hope, and you can start making progress today.”
Build and mobilize social self-efficacy
Believing that you’re in control of your future is an important antecedent to both improving immediate wellbeing and for motivating the pursuit of long-term goals - our program design instills students with the confidence to be the authors of their own social destinies.
Create resilient social support networks for robust stress management
The university experience should be intellectually challenging, not emotionally overwhelming. By fostering supportive communities and nurturing a hopeful outlook, we can prevent students from descending into despair, turning stressors into manageable challenges instead of debilitating crises.
Empower everyone to be community builders
Everybody needs social connections, and anyone can become a valued member of somebody else’s social network. That person can be you.
Meet students where they are, with solutions they value
We recognize that students have diverse needs and varying amounts of time and energy. Our program design tailors sets of components matched to to each individual, which they can engage with at their chosen pace and depth.
Be accessible to everyone everywhere all at once
Students need help now. So our online course will be available to anyone free of charge, and a deployment kit will enable professors to make it a part of their classes immediately.
